#051569 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#051569 is composed of 2% red, 8.2%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.2% cyan, 80% magenta, 0%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 230.4 degrees, a saturation of 90.9% and a lightness of 21.6%. #051569 color hex could be obtained by blending #0a2ad2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

#051569 color description : Very dark blue.

#051569 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#051569 has RGB values of R:5, G:21,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0.8, Y:0,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 333161.

Shades and Tints of #051569

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01020b is the darkest color, while #f8f9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#051569

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#34353a is the less saturated color, while #01126d is the most saturated one.
